Transaction e6b70f980692241714eefde34bcf64dfb7fea013a9e323d44dc4c37fbb565b00
1 Input
1 Output
-
e6b70f980692241714eefde34bcf64dfb7fea013a9e323d44dc4c37fbb565b00:0
- value
- 7404319
- script pubkey
- OP_0 OP_PUSHBYTES_20 3a0f9d50b979e7b2781d0e5a3ebe147751c517de
- address
- bc1q8g8e659e08nmy7qapedra0s5wagu29776xf7ar